We are seeking a Permanency Supervisor (Child Welfare Supervisor 2) to join our Gresham team. Summary of Duties As a Permanency Supervisor, you will: Engage and supervise staff by planning, executing, monitoring, and evaluating activities related to ODHS and Child Welfare. Ensure staff adhere to good social work practices, state and federal laws, and department policies. Continuously review programs and standards affecting quality, safety, and permanency of children's lives. Provide general training, orientation, mentoring, and consultations to staff. Maintain cooperative relationships with staff, community partners, children, and families. Make informed decisions regarding the level and type of services provided to client families. Review and approve work. Minimum Qualifications A bachelor’s degree in human services or a field related to human services AND two years of lead work, supervision, or progressively related human services experience; OR A bachelor’s degree unrelated to human services AND completion of coursework equivalent to certification consistent with Oregon Caseworker Competency AND two years of lead work, supervision, OR progressively related experience in human services; OR An associate degree AND three years of human services related experience two years of which must have included lead work, supervision, or progressively related experience; OR An associate degree and completion of coursework equivalent to certification consistent with Oregon Caseworker Competency AND two years of lead work, supervision, or progressively related experience in human services. Essential Attributes We are looking for candidates with: Experience developing and managing a case load or case plan related to safety practice models. Experience implementing organizational objectives and ensuring that the necessary quantity and quality of work is achieved. Experience supervising and managing a work unit including hiring, training employees, assigning, and reviewing work, providing employees with feedback on their performance, providing oversight of operations, and managing staff performance. Experience with project management and continuous quality improvement. Experience creating and maintaining a work environment that is respectful, facilitates the development of teams and is a professional model of leadership for staff. Experience developing constructive and cooperative working relationships with partners and community members and maintain them over time. Working Conditions Work Locations: Offices, homes of participants, and community sites. Travel: Occasional travel for meetings, trainings, and other case related activities. This includes required occasional overnight travel. Hours: Regular work week with fluctuating hours; occasional overtime may be needed, including evenings and weekends. On-Call: You’ll be part of a rotating on-call schedule that includes evenings and weekends. Physical Requirements: Frequent physical activity, including lifting up to 50 pounds and assisting children with car seats. This role involves handling sensitive topics related to trauma, abuse, and crises, requiring a trauma-informed approach that is essential to ensure a safe environment. You may interact with individuals who have experienced trauma and may have difficulty managing their emotions. Be prepared for stressful situations that require quick decision-making to ensure safety for yourself and others.
